Presented by Ars Lyrica Houston
Classical Collaborations brings together the central genres of the Viennese classical “school”—concerto, sonata, symphony, and variations—while foregrounding the contributions of women to this fabled musical culture. Featured works include Marianna Martines’s Concerto in G Major for Fortepiano and Orchestra, Mozart’s “Auernhammer” Sonata in F Major (K. 376), Joseph Haydn’s Symphony No. 48 (“Maria Theresia”), and Josepha Auernhammer’s “Papageno Variations.”

Grammy-nominated ensemble Ars Lyrica Houston specializes in music from the Baroque era, transporting listeners back in time to the “golden age” of the seventeenth and eighteenth centuries. Through performances on period instruments with careful attention to historical style and context, Ars Lyrica brings imaginative, world-class performances of early music to Houston.
